Are you noticing your Windows 10 PC slowing down or struggling with multitasking? Memory (RAM) issues are a common culprit, but optimizing how your system uses RAM can yield a smoother, more responsive experience. Windows 10 offers several built-in and third-party optimization techniques that, when used correctly, can make a big difference. This guide covers proven memory optimization methods for intermediate users, along with real-world advice and specific steps to follow.
Why Does Memory Optimization Matter on Windows 10?
RAM is essential for running programs and keeping your computer fast. When memory runs low, Windows relies on the page file (virtual memory), which is stored on your much slower hard drive or SSD. Excessive use of virtual memory leads to lag and long waiting times. Optimizing memory usage ensures that your PC runs applications smoothly without unnecessary delays.
What Built-in Windows 10 Tools Help Manage Memory?
Windows 10 includes several utilities to monitor and manage RAM. Here’s how you can use them:
Task Manager: Press Ctrl + Shift + Esc or right-click the taskbar and select Task Manager. The “Processes” tab shows which applications are using the most memory. Right-click any unnecessary process and select End task to free up RAM.
Startup Manager: Still in Task Manager, switch to the “Startup” tab. Disable non-essential programs that start with Windows. This reduces memory use right from boot.
Settings > System > Storage: Use Storage Sense to automatically delete temporary files. While this primarily helps with storage, it can also indirectly improve memory usage by reducing background processes.
How Can You Adjust Virtual Memory for Better Performance?
By default, Windows 10 manages virtual memory automatically. However, manually adjusting it can sometimes improve performance for systems with limited RAM.
1. Right-click This PC and choose Properties.
2. Click Advanced system settings.
3. In the System Properties window, under the Advanced tab, click Settings under Performance.
4. Go to the Advanced tab and click Change under Virtual memory.
5. Uncheck “Automatically manage paging file size for all drives.”
6. Select your system drive, choose Custom size, and set the initial and maximum size. A common recommendation is to set both values to 1.5 to 2 times your installed RAM (so for 8GB RAM, set to 12288MB–16384MB).
7. Click Set and then OK. Restart your PC.
What Role Do Background Processes and Services Play?
Too many background applications and services can eat up valuable RAM. Here’s how to optimize:
Disable unnecessary startup items as shown above.
Open the Services app (type services.msc in the Start menu) and review services set to “Automatic.” If you recognize a service you don’t use (for example, Bluetooth Support Service on a desktop without Bluetooth), you can set it to Manual.
Be careful: Only change service settings if you’re sure of their purpose.
How Can Glary Utilities Help Optimize and Free Up Memory?
Third-party tools like Glary Utilities offer an easy way to handle multiple optimization tasks from one place, making them ideal for intermediate users who want a streamlined process.
Glary Utilities features for memory optimization:
Memory Optimizer: Frees up unused RAM with a single click. This is useful after closing heavy applications or before launching resource-intensive programs.
Startup Manager: Offers more detailed control over startup items than Windows’ built-in manager. You can delay or completely disable entries for improved memory availability.
Registry Cleaner: Cleans invalid entries that may cause memory leaks or system instability.
Automatic Maintenance: Schedules regular cleanups that can help maintain optimal memory usage over time.
Real-world example: If you often use Chrome with many tabs or run large spreadsheets, try running the Memory Optimizer in Glary Utilities after closing these apps. You’ll likely notice the system becoming more responsive.
Should You Upgrade Your RAM, and When?
Software tweaks work well up to a point, but if your system still struggles with memory-intensive tasks (like video editing or running virtual machines), it may be time to add more physical RAM. Check your system’s specifications for compatibility and consider upgrading to at least 8GB (or 16GB for heavy multitasking).
What About Memory-Heavy Applications?
Some applications are notorious for using a lot of RAM—browsers with dozens of tabs, photo editors, or certain games. To optimize:
Regularly close unused tabs and applications.
Use browser extensions like The Great Suspender, which “suspends” inactive tabs to free up memory.
Check for “lite” or alternative versions of resource-hungry software.
How Do You Monitor Progress and Make Adjustments?
After applying any of these memory optimization techniques, monitor the effect:
Open Task Manager and watch the Memory column under Performance.
If performance improves, keep the new settings. If not, revisit recent changes or consider additional upgrades or alternative solutions.
Summary: What Works Best for Intermediate Users?
For most Windows 10 users, the best memory optimization approach is:
Regularly clean up startup items and background processes.
Adjust virtual memory if needed, especially on systems with lower RAM.
Use Glary Utilities to automate memory cleanup, optimize startup, and maintain a healthy system.
Monitor your system with Task Manager and address memory-heavy applications as needed.
Consider hardware upgrades if persistent slowdowns occur.
By combining built-in Windows features, smart manual adjustments, and comprehensive tools like Glary Utilities, you can keep your Windows 10 system running efficiently and make the most of your available memory.